Transaction 242f18204bc4af65ed3bde298249acef3520c657218dcce5e02420768704e154

1 Input
2 Outputs
  • 242f18204bc4af65ed3bde298249acef3520c657218dcce5e02420768704e154:0
  • value  30528982
    address  3LnLNWd12ZMyEEtgXoy9T1SCFhMJysfYDC
  • 242f18204bc4af65ed3bde298249acef3520c657218dcce5e02420768704e154:1
  • value  640575
    address  18ZiiCBmzDaaFoPREofsAA9FfUhJAwmMSx